WebMar 19, 2024 · Higher Salaries. Having more Japanese women fully employed in more meaningful roles will also lead to better salaries. That, in turn, will increase the domestic consumer base: more money will be made, so more money will be spent. It’s a virtuous circle that the Japanese patriarchy, through inertia and cultural scaffolding, continues to impede.
